Package: watchdog
Version: 5.2.5-2

I am having the exact same problem, on 12 out of 12 debian testing
machines.  Hardware, software, and architecture are widely variable.
All are running custom 2.6 kernels however.

I don't know about R?mi, but here are the answers to the questions you
asked from my point of view:

It hangs, whether upgrading (or retrying the failed upgrade),
reinstalling, removing and installing, or installing fresh.  This is
only true (in my experience) for version 5.2.5-2.  In 5.2.5-1, it hangs
ONLY when upgrading, and completes successfully if you kill it and retry
the failed upgrade.  All other versions have worked perfectly for me.

The postinst script seems to go defunct.  I dunno how to actually make
ps print ppid's, but here is a `ps faux`:

root      3551  0.0  0.8   2828  1620 pts/0    S    20:08   0:00  | \_ bash
root      3686  3.0 20.9  41544 39940 pts/0    S+   20:19   0:23  |     \_ 
dselect
root      4790 27.4 14.0  28024 26880 pts/0    S+   20:31   0:10  |         \_ 
dpkg --admindir /var/lib/dpkg --pending
root      4792 22.7  4.3  10060  8340 pts/0    S+   20:31   0:06  |             
\_ /usr/bin/perl -w /usr/share/debconf/frontend /var/lib/dpkg/info/wat
root      4803  0.3  0.0      0     0 pts/0    Z+   20:31   0:00  |             
    \_ [watchdog.postin] <defunct>

And another:

root      3551  0.0  0.8   2828  1624 pts/0    S    20:08   0:00  | \_ bash
root      5040  3.1  5.7  12912 10940 pts/0    S+   20:42   0:07  |     \_ 
apt-get install watchdog
root      5045  4.6 14.0  28020 26868 pts/0    S+   20:42   0:10  |         \_ 
/usr/bin/dpkg --status-fd 27 --configure watchdog
root      5046  2.9  4.3  10068  8344 pts/0    S+   20:42   0:06  |             
 \_ /usr/bin/perl -w /usr/share/debconf/frontend /var/lib/dpkg/info/wat
root      5056  0.0  0.0      0     0 pts/0    Z+   20:42   0:00  |             
     \_ [watchdog.postin] <defunct>

A new watchdog process IS running at this point.

And here is the output from the terminal (a previous watchdog upgrade
hung and was killed prior to this):

spaceheater:~# apt-get install watchdog   
Reading package lists... Done
Building dependency tree... Done
watchdog is already the newest version.
0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
1 not fully installed or removed.
Need to get 0B of archives.
After unpacking 0B of additional disk space will be used.
Setting up watchdog (5.2.5-2) ...
Restarting watchdog daemon...done.

*** HANGS here (I let it sit for as long as 48 hours in prior tests)
*** I now hit ctrl+c 

dpkg: error processing watchdog (--configure):
 subprocess post-installation script killed by signal (Interrupt)
Errors were encountered while processing:
 watchdog
E: Sub-process /usr/bin/dpkg returned an error code (1)
spaceheater:~# apt-get remove watchdog
Reading package lists... Done
Building dependency tree... Done
The following packages will be REMOVED:
  watchdog
0 upgraded, 0 newly installed, 1 to remove and 0 not upgraded.
1 not fully installed or removed.
Need to get 0B of archives.
After unpacking 254kB disk space will be freed.
Do you want to continue [Y/n]? y
(Reading database ... 69192 files and directories currently installed.)
Removing watchdog ...
spaceheater:~# apt-get install watchdog
Reading package lists... Done
Building dependency tree... Done
The following NEW packages will be installed:
  watchdog
0 upgraded, 1 newly installed, 0 to remove and 0 not upgraded.
Need to get 0B/59.1kB of archives.
After unpacking 254kB of additional disk space will be used.
Preconfiguring packages ...
Selecting previously deselected package watchdog.
(Reading database ... 69173 files and directories currently installed.)
Unpacking watchdog (from .../watchdog_5.2.5-2_i386.deb) ...
Setting up watchdog (5.2.5-2) ...
Restarting watchdog daemon...done.

*** HUNG again, ctrl+c

dpkg: error processing watchdog (--configure):
 subprocess post-installation script killed by signal (Interrupt)
Errors were encountered while processing:
 watchdog
E: Sub-process /usr/bin/dpkg returned an error code (1)
spaceheater:~# apt-get install watchdog
Reading package lists... Done
Building dependency tree... Done
watchdog is already the newest version.
0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
1 not fully installed or removed.
Need to get 0B of archives.
After unpacking 0B of additional disk space will be used.
Setting up watchdog (5.2.5-2) ...
Restarting watchdog daemon...done.

*** HUNG again

On Sun, May 14, 2006 at 02:21:39PM +0200, Michael Meskes wrote:
> tag 367126 unreproducible
> tag 367126 moreinfo
> thanks
> 
> > While upgrading to 5.2.5-2, I get...
> > ...
> > ...and apt-get is still there after a bunch of minutes.
> 
> Seems to work for me. Does it als hang if you remove and then reinstall
> watchdog? Which other processes related to the watchdog update are still
> running? Could you send me a ps output that also contains PPID
> information?
> 
> Michael
> -- 
> Michael Meskes
> Email: Michael at Fam-Meskes dot De, Michael at Meskes dot (De|Com|Net|Org)
> ICQ: 179140304, AIM/Yahoo: michaelmeskes, Jabber: [EMAIL PROTECTED]
> Go SF 49ers! Go Rhein Fire! Use Debian GNU/Linux! Use PostgreSQL!
> 
> 
>


-- 
To UNSUBSCRIBE, email to [EMAIL PROTECTED]
with a subject of "unsubscribe". Trouble? Contact [EMAIL PROTECTED]

Reply via email to